Loading...

2008年7月9日星期三

网卡 mac 跳动 解决方法

之前使用ubuntu8.04的时候,每次登录都要使用不同的ip地址,eth0,eth1,eth2,不停的往上跳,无意中发现时每次开机网卡mac都会改变的原故,google了一番后发现解决的方法:

The Solution:
我们来打开 /etc/udev/rules.d/70-persistent-net.rules, 会发现一大段类似下面的代码,如果每行的ATTRS{address}值都不一样,这样就说明了以上的问题了,也就是找到了问题出处。先把这些代码删掉,或者用#注释掉

Code:
# PCI device 0x10de:0x0450 (forcedeth)
SUBSYSTEM=="net", DRIVERS=="?*",ATTRS{address}=="af:52:de:7d:1d:00", NAME="eth0"
打开终端,执行lspci,找出ethernet contriller的id,例如下面的代码段,id是00:06.0
Code:
00:02.1 USB Controller: nVidia Corporation MCP65 USB Controller (rev a3)
00:06.0 Ethernet controller: nVidia Corporation MCP65 Ethernet (rev a3)
00:07.0 Audio device: nVidia Corporation MCP65 High Definition Audio (rev a1)
the number we need is 0000:00:06.0 (may vary on your system).

修改/etc/udev/rules.d/70-persistent-net.rules ,例如id是00:06.0就加上下面这一段。
Code:
# PCI device 0x10de:0x0450 (forcedeth)
SUBSYSTEM=="net", DRIVERS=="?*", ID=="0000:00:06.0", NAME="eth0"
打开 /etc/network/interfaces,写入
auto lo
iface lo inet loopback

auto eth0
iface eth0 inet dhcp
pre-up ifconfig eth0 hw ether 00:15:F2:A7:37:42

(根据自己的mac地址代替00:15:F2:A7:37:42)

,restart,这样应该就ok了。

转载自:http://ubuntuforums.org/showthread.php?p=4156690#post4156690

阅读全文...

ubuntu 下 wine 迅雷5的安装 比较完善的方法。

现在linux下的下载工具还是比较好用的,不过习惯用迅雷的朋友们,想在linux下找代替的工具,还是比较的难。有些人说,使用国际版迅雷 (Gigaget)代替迅雷,确实wine对gigaget的兼容性比较理想,不过个人感觉gigaget在找源方面就比较难(在教育网上测试过,与迅 雷5对比,不知道其他网络如何),下面我们介绍一下wine 迅雷5的方法。

这个方法我是在ubuntu的中文官方论坛上看到的:
http://forum.ubuntu.org.cn/viewtopic.php?t=100304&postdays=0&pos×der=asc&start=0

1,首先是要安装ies4linux(如果ies4linux安装包下没有自带wine,我的版本就是这个,要先安装wine,否则安装ies4linux时会提示找不到wine)

2, 下载并安装迅雷5,可以原版,这里建议用安装版不用绿色版,可以兼用ies4Linux。(如果你的wine 和ies4linux分开安装就会出现两个wine的配置,真正的wine配置和ies4linux的wine配置,我们不能直接安装到wine下,因为 这样迅雷会默认安装到wine下而不是ies4linux自带配置的wine下,如果不理解我说的话,不紧要,只要在下载时使用ies4linux下载, 并在ies4linux下打开,就可以了。)

3, 安装过程中可能会报错,不仅要的。安装完后,我们还需要做一些配置,添加一些mfc*.dll的文件到wine下的system32文件夹,路 径:/home/用户名/.ies4linux/ie6/drive_c/windows/system32/,这些文件在哪?你的c: /windows/system32下就有了。ies4linux下的system32原来已经有部分的dll,不要覆盖它,跳过(skip)就好了。还 有一个文件 atl71.dll 也要换成ansi版本的,这个文件放到迅雷的安装目录的program子目录下,默认是这个目录
/home/用户名/.ies4linux/ie6/drive_c/Program Files/Thunder Network/Thunder/Program

4,完成了,另外有人反映,可以跳过安装ies4linux的步骤,直接把wine配置成模拟win98就行了。大家可以试一下,可以的话告诉我一声。

补充:安装后可能存在的一些问题:

1,不能使用迅雷看看,郁闷。

2,不能正常关闭迅雷,在我的机子里关闭迅雷后thunder5.exe资源占用会反而暴涨。 cpu占用上99%。可以手动删除,kill 了它,就可以解决,或者不关闭迅雷就可以了。

安装迅雷的步骤就到这里了,如果你使用双系统,而且两边都用迅雷,可以配置两个迅雷同步进度:

1,在 /home/用户名/.ies4linux/ie6/dosdrive/创建链接d,e,f。。。等等(千万不要更换原来的链接c)链接到windows对应下的本地硬盘。

2,删除 /home/用户名/.ies4linux/ie6/drive_c/Program Files/Thunder Network/Thunder/Profiles文件夹,创建链接Profiles,链接到windows的迅雷下的Profiles文件夹。

3,好了,完成,不过以后不要用迅雷下载文件到c盘下,否则会造成混乱。

OK,ubuntu下的迅雷安装就顺利完成了,汗,第一次写那么长的文章,希望对你有用。

另外,如果想用迅雷看看,可以试下安装windows media player到ies4linux,可能就是缺这个。这个我没试过,在wineqh上有教程。成功了一定要告诉我方法啊。期待你成功~~

原发布于http://tamamaxox.blog.ubuntu.org.cn/category/ubuntu/,08年7月挪至此处

原创文章如转载,请注明:转载自HATA菜谱


阅读全文...